Jake is going on a trip. He and Mom take a taxi to the airport. “It’s my first
plane trip,” he tells the taxi driver. “That’s great!” the taxi driver says. Jake
rolls his suitcase onto the plane. “It’s my first plane trip,” he tells the pilot.
“Welcome aboard,” the pilot says. Jake finds his seat and buckles his seatbelt.
The plane’s engines rumble and roar. Jake opens his backpack and pulls out
Panda. “It’s my first plane trip,” he whispers. He holds Panda’s paw. The plane
moves faster and faster. Then—Whoosh! On the ground, cars and houses look
like toys. Jake smiles. “Guess what, Panda?” he says. “Flying is fun!

One misty morning, Chloe and Joey were looking around their backyard. They
were sitting on the grass. Joey saw a rock with little plants on it. “Look at that
mossy green rock!” Joey cried. “That is not a rock,” Chloe said. “It’s a dinner
table for snails.” A snail inched over to the rock to munch on the plants. Next,
Joey saw a leaf. “Look at that pretty yellow leaf!” Joey cried. “That is not a
leaf,” Chloe said. “It’s a blanket for beetles.” A beetle crawled under the warm
leaf. Then, Joey saw a flower. “Look at that red flower!” Joey cried. “That is not
a flower,” Chloe said. “It’s a shower for worms.” A worm played in the water
under the flower as dewdrops dripped from the petals. “Look at that wild
mushroom!” Joey cried. “That is not a mushroom,” Chloe said. “It’s an
umbrella for spiders.” A spider knit a web under the mushroom away from the
mist. Finally, Joey saw a stick. “Look at that squiggly–” Joey stopped. If he
called it a stick, Chloe would say it was not a stick. So, Joey cried, “Look at that
squiggly ladybug ladder!” Chloe grinned at Joey and said, “Now you're seeing
things from another point of view!”

Visit Italy: Italy is the fifth most visited country in the world. Why? Because
there is so much to see and do there! People visit Italy to see its fantastic
architecture, to explore ancient ruins and learn about their history, and–of
course–to eat wonderful Italian food!
Visit Rome: See the Coliseum. This huge arena was built about 72 C.E., and
it’s still standing! Many people think it is the greatest work of Roman
architecture ever built. Explore the Coliseum and learn what the ancient
Romans used this enormous building for.
Visit Florence: This is wonderful city for exploring museums and looking at
beautiful architecture.
Visit Venice: Venice is one of the most beautiful cities in the world. A popular
thing to do in this city is to eat a delicious Italian dinner and then take a
gondola, or boat ride, through the canals.
Visit Pompeii: Explore the ancient city of Pompeii. Walk through the ruins
and experience history. Discover what life was like for Romans in 79. C.E.
when the city was buried by the eruption of the volcano Mount Vesuvius.
